RYA Youth Stage 3/4 in Fevas
This intermediate course is designed to enhance the skills needed to sail around a course and build self-reliance on the water. The course covers rigging, sailing theory, launching and recovery, efficient sailing at all angles to the wind and boat control manoeuvres, building confidence in a range of sailing techniques on all points of sail and capsize recovery.
At the end of the course, successful sailors will be able to launch and sail a dinghy on all points of sail around a triangle in moderate conditions. and understand the basic principles needed to become a confident sailor. Stage 3 skills are the minimum required to usefully participate in club cadet racing.
Stage 4 develops Stage 3 skills into double-handed dinghies.
There is a considerable jump in skills and ability required to successfully complete Stage 3. Ideally students will have gained additional sailing experience and confidence since completing Stage 2.
Recommended Age: 10 - 14
Entry Requirements: Minimum age 10. Sailing ability to an absolute minimum of RYA Stage 2 is required, ideally with some additional sailing experience..
